University
, located in , , is one of the eleven faculties of the University of Liège. Founded in 1860 and previously known as the Faculté universitaire des sciences agronomiques de Gembloux, it is Belgium's oldest educational and research institution dedicated to agronomic sciences and biological engineering. is situated 3½ km southwest of Cimetière de Sauvenière.
